in case you don't know what i'm talking about, our country's Lee Chong Wei (world number 2) has managed to make it to the badminton men's singles' finals! He will be contending for either a silver or a gold medal. ain't that cool?! it will be malaysia's first medal since 1996 and fourth medal ever. (so, so few.) if he wins a gold medal, it will be malaysia's first olympic gold medal, ever. but he'll be up against the world number 1, Lin Dan from china. at least, i think that's who he's up against. if he wins, it will be pretty damn awesome. he'll get a datukship and malaysia will throw him a parade and he'll get RM1million (that's the reward malaysia gives for an olympic gold medal). imagine if the US gave that reward.
